What is the Wesleyan University Petition Form?
The Wesleyan University Petition Form is an essential document that students utilize to request modifications in their course enrollment, such as adding or dropping courses. This form is designed to streamline the academic petition process and ensure that all necessary parties are involved in the decision-making. In addition to students, instructors, advisors, and deans are required to participate in the submission process.
This form serves various purposes, including providing a structured way for students to address academic changes and ensuring that all relevant details are formally documented. The parties involved must thoroughly complete the form to facilitate an effective review.

Who Needs the Wesleyan University Petition Form?
The need for the Wesleyan University Petition Form extends to several stakeholders within the academic environment. Below is a breakdown of the roles involved in the petition process:
-
Students: The primary users of the form who request enrollment changes.
-
Instructors: Teachers must provide their insights into the student’s petition and sign the form.
-
Advisors: Academic advisors guide students and validate their requests.
-
Deans: Deans review the petitions and grant final approval.
Each role is vital in ensuring that the petition aligns with the university's academic policies and procedures.

How to fill out the Wesleyan University Petition Form
-
1.To access the Wesleyan University Petition Form, visit pdfFiller and search for the form name. Click on the form to open it in the pdfFiller interface.
-
2.Once the form is open, navigate to each field and click on the blank spaces to start filling out the required information. Use the text tool to enter your details.
-
3.Before starting, gather necessary information such as your name, class year, faculty advisor's name, WesID, WesPO, email, and phone number. This will ensure you can complete the form efficiently.
-
4.Fill out the 'Statement of Student' section to explain your reason for the petition. Ensure clarity and provide any needed context to facilitate understanding.
-
5.Next, complete the 'Statement of Instructor' section where your instructor will outline their perspective on the petition. Ensure your instructor is aware and prepared to review this part.
-
6.Once all sections are filled, review the form thoroughly. Check for accuracy of information and ensure all required fields are completed.
-
7.To finalize the form, use pdfFiller's features to sign the document electronically. Ensure that all necessary parties, including your advisor and dean, can sign as required.
-
8.After reviewing and signing, you can save your completed form. Use the download option to save a copy for your records or submit it directly through pdfFiller as instructed.
Who is eligible to use the Wesleyan University Petition Form?
This form is designed for current students at Wesleyan University who wish to request changes in their course enrollment. Instructors and advisors also engage with the form during the approval process.
What is the deadline for submitting the petition?
Deadlines for submitting the Wesleyan University Petition Form typically align with the academic calendar. For specific dates, check with the Registrar's Office or consult course enrollment guidelines.
How can I submit the Wesleyan University Petition Form?
You can submit the completed form electronically via pdfFiller, or print it out for manual submission to the appropriate administrative office, such as the Registrar or your department's office.
What supporting documents are required with the form?
You may need to attach any relevant documentation that supports your request, such as course syllabi or correspondence with your instructor regarding the changes. Check with your advisor for specific requirements.
What common mistakes should I avoid when filling out the form?
Ensure all fields are filled in accurately, especially personal information and signatures. Avoid leaving blank fields, as incomplete forms may be denied or delayed in processing.
How long does it take to process the petition once submitted?
Processing times for the Wesleyan University Petition Form can vary. Generally, allow a few weeks for review and feedback from the committee, especially during peak enrollment periods.
Is notarization required for the Wesleyan University Petition Form?
No, notarization is not required for this petition form. However, all required signatures from the student, instructor, advisor, and dean must be secured for it to be processed.
